{Source: B.Tech students & alumni]Saraswati College of Engineering Kharghar has a vibrant campus life, where girl students have ample freedom to move around and express themselves. The dress code is relaxed, and students can wear whatever makes them comfortable. The mess food is of acceptable quality, and the cooking arrangements are hygienic. Attendance is taken seriously, and incomplete attendance may result in penalties. The college culture is diverse, with no language challenges, and the support staff speaks primarily in their native language. Academically, the college has a relatively hectic schedule with regular exams and tests, and students must study throughout the year to perform well. Teaching methodologies include practical discussions based on case studies, and there are plenty of research and reading resources available in the well-stocked library. The college is secure, with guards and CCTV cameras present everywhere, and outsiders are allowed to move around the campus without permission. However, the college takes ragging very seriously and can rusticate students if found guilty. Overall, Saraswati College of Engineering Kharghar provides an inclusive and supportive learning environment for its students.Based on the reviews provided, the overall infrastructure of Saraswati College of Engineering Kharghar is mixed. Smt. Saraswati Gurupadappa Nagamarapalli College of Nursing has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ses: CoursesEligibilityB.Sc. (Post Basic)Candidates should be registered as Registered Nurses and Registered Midwives (RNRM).
Candidates should possess a three-year Diploma in General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M).
Candidates should have a minimum of two years of experience in the profession (after registration as RNRM).B.Sc.Candidate must have passed 10+2 examination with Science stream from a recognised board.
